    Job DescriptionPosition Description: Picker packers typically work in warehouses filling orders and assisting with the inventory. They work closely with vendors and warehouse staff to pick up and process orders as they come in. They must be familiar with the layout of the warehouse and inventory and be able to pick and move items as requested. Picker packers need to document items they move to fill orders, so they must have excellent attention to detail and be good with numbers. They pack items, scan barcodes, and move packages to the correct location for shipping. Picker packers are responsible for inspecting merchandise and products to ensure they have the right items, are not damaged, and nothing is missing per the order. Knowledge, Skills and Abilities: Math - Knowledge of basic math (addition and subtraction) Physical Requirements: Heavy lifting up to 65 pounds Comfortable walking/standing 90% of the day.

How much does a picker earn in Jackson, NJ?

The average picker in Jackson, NJ earns between $23,000 and $37,000 annually. This compares to the national average picker range of $25,000 to $37,000.
